The ‘Flash’ star, as Warner Bros. won’t reprise the role in the DCEU going forward, is said to be on outs, after a yet to be released flick starring himself as Barry Allen this final time. This is according to Deadline, which seems to have softened its position, but it is still suggesting about outs of the role.

Here’s what Deadline first said about Miller’s future “In (David) Zaslav’s plan to make DC an explosively successful division like Marvel under his newly structured studio, with its own new boss, the non-binary identifying Miller, we hear, is simply not a part of those plans going forward in the future universe regardless if there are more allegations or not.”

Deadline has since revised its story to read … “Sources said even if no more allegations surface, the studio won’t likely keep Miller in the Flash role in future DC films. That would mean replacing him in the future, but there is still a $200 million investment on the line with the first film and Warner Bros execs have to be cringing at each new press report.”

Indeed, WB kept them around but the other reporters confirmed the news about it’s appearing outs of Ezra. WB praying for no more negative headlines emerge for Ezra Miller but on the that have surfaced thus far a source told Deadline, “There is no winning in this for Warner Bros. This is an inherited problem for Zaslav. The hope is that the scandal will remain at a low level before the movie is released, and hope for the best to turn out.”
